Senior Security Analyst(m/w/x)
Leading incident response and guiding first responders, validating security plans for a large Austrian employer. Completed studies in IT security or CISSP/GIAC certification required. Staff shopping and travel discounts.
Requirements
- 3+/5+/8+ years relevant professional experience as security analyst or similar in SOC
- Completed studies (computer science, information security, IT security, cybersecurity) or comparable hands-on training
- CISSP and/or GIAC or similar certifications (beneficial)
- Experience solving problems/conflicts in complex corporate structures
- Strong problem-solving and troubleshooting skills
- Ability to work well under pressure, maintaining professional image
- Ability to perform independent analysis of complex problems
- Ability to communicate complex/technical issues to diverse audiences
- Strong decision-making capabilities
- Knowledge of SOC frameworks/standards (Cyber Kill Chain, MITTRE)
- Proven record using SIEM, XDR, EDR, NDR, PAM solutions
- Technical knowledge of Splunk, SentinelOne, Proofpoint, Cyberark (advantage)
- Technical expertise in network security (VPN, firewall, web server, Cloud)
- Specific OT and IoT knowledge (plus)
- Knowledge of at least one scripting language (Perl, Python, PowerShell)
- Precise, responsible mindset and reliability
- Very good presentation and moderation skills
- Entrepreneurial mindset and strong analytical/conceptual skills
- Highly proficient spoken and written English
- Willingness to learn local language
Tasks
- Continuously monitor and analyze data from SOC tools
- Investigate security events, alerts, and incidents
- Provide insights from post-incident analysis to improve security
- Respond to security incidents per policy and procedures
- Provide technical guidance to first responders
- Provide timely updates to stakeholders and decision-makers
- Communicate investigation findings to improve security posture
- Validate and maintain incident response plans and processes
- Compile and analyze data for management reporting and metrics
- Monitor information sources for current attacks and trends
- Analyze the impact of new security threats
- Develop new use cases with engineers to improve capabilities
- Perform or participate in root-cause analysis
- Document root-cause analysis findings
- Participate in root-cause elimination activities
- Create runbooks for frequently occurring incidents
- Onboard new data sources and systems to expand tooling
- Collaborate with infrastructure and security teams
- Support an open feedback and learning culture
- Identify potential security risks
- Forward security risks to relevant authorities
